Synopsis:

Shook is a contemporary theatrical performance created by NUS Stage, looking at the hopes, challenges and dreams of our times.

With the use of original text, movement, video and sound, the ensemble presents a polyphonic spectacle with a party of lovable and problematic characters, memes and moments for you to love and hate.

In a time of digital domination, gender upheaval, cancel culture, and environmental doom, let's take a moment to be shook and be heard.
